clawdbot脚本导入有四种方式:一、命令行直接执行python clawdbot_main.py;二、作为模块导入需配置pythonpath并添加__init__.py;三、pip install -e .可编辑安装;四、docker容器化运行需dockerfile和挂载。

如果您已下载Clawdbot自动化脚本但无法将其正确导入到运行环境中,则可能是由于脚本格式不匹配、路径配置错误或依赖缺失所致。以下是完成Clawdbot脚本导入与基础配置的几种可行方式:
一、通过命令行直接执行Python脚本
该方法适用于本地已安装Python 3.8及以上版本且Clawdbot脚本为.py格式的场景,可绕过复杂配置直接验证脚本可运行性。
1、打开终端(macOS/Linux)或命令提示符(Windows),进入Clawdbot脚本所在目录。
2、输入命令:python clawdbot_main.py(若系统默认为Python 3,请使用python3 clawdbot_main.py)。
3、观察控制台输出,如出现“Clawdbot initialized”或类似初始化日志,表明脚本已成功加载并启动。
二、将脚本作为模块导入至主程序
该方式适用于需将Clawdbot功能嵌入现有Python项目中,要求脚本具备标准模块结构(含__init__.py)并位于Python路径可识别范围内。
1、确认Clawdbot脚本根目录下存在__init__.py文件(可为空,但必须存在)。
2、在主程序所在目录中,执行:export PYTHONPATH="${PYTHONPATH}:/path/to/clawdbot"(Linux/macOS)或set PYTHONPATH=%PYTHONPATH%;C:\path\to\clawdbot(Windows)。
3、在主程序.py文件中添加导入语句:from clawdbot.core import ClawdbotEngine(具体模块路径依实际目录结构而定)。
三、使用pip install -e进行可编辑安装
该方法将Clawdbot脚本注册为本地可编辑包,支持实时修改代码并立即生效,适合开发调试阶段。
1、进入Clawdbot脚本根目录,确认其中包含setup.py文件(内容至少含name、version、packages字段)。
2、运行命令:pip install -e .(注意末尾英文句点不可省略)。
3、在任意Python环境中执行import clawdbot,无报错即表示导入成功。
四、通过Docker容器加载脚本文件
该方式适用于隔离运行环境、规避宿主机依赖冲突,要求Clawdbot脚本已适配容器化部署(如含requirements.txt和启动入口)。
1、在Clawdbot脚本目录中创建Dockerfile,内容包含COPY . /app及WORKDIR /app指令。
2、构建镜像:docker build -t clawdbot-local .
3、运行容器并挂载脚本目录:docker run -v $(pwd):/app clawdbot-local python /app/clawdbot_main.py。






